Understanding Small Jaw Crushers

Before we dive into the topic of energy efficiency, let's first understand what small jaw crushers are. These machines are a type of primary crusher used in various industries, including mining, construction, and recycling. They work by compressing materials between two jaws - a fixed jaw and a moving jaw. The moving jaw exerts force on the material, breaking it into smaller pieces.

Jaw Rock Crushers are a common type of small jaw crusher. They are designed to handle hard and abrasive materials, such as rocks and ores. Their compact size and high crushing ratio make them ideal for small-scale operations and mobile applications.

Factors Affecting Energy Efficiency

Several factors influence the energy efficiency of small jaw crushers. Understanding these factors can help operators optimize their equipment and reduce energy consumption.

1. Design and Construction

The design and construction of a small jaw crusher play a crucial role in its energy efficiency. Modern crushers are designed with advanced features that minimize energy loss. For example, some crushers use a toggle plate system that reduces the amount of energy required to move the moving jaw. Additionally, the use of high-quality materials in the construction of the crusher can improve its durability and reduce maintenance requirements, which in turn can lead to energy savings.

2. Crushing Chamber Design

The design of the crushing chamber also affects energy efficiency. A well-designed crushing chamber ensures that the material is evenly distributed and crushed, reducing the amount of energy required to break it down. Some crushers use a deep crushing chamber design, which increases the crushing ratio and reduces the number of passes required to achieve the desired particle size.

3. Motor Efficiency

The motor is the heart of a small jaw crusher, and its efficiency directly impacts the overall energy consumption of the machine. High-efficiency motors are designed to convert electrical energy into mechanical energy with minimal losses. When selecting a small jaw crusher, it's important to choose one with a motor that has a high efficiency rating.

4. Operating Conditions

The operating conditions of a small jaw crusher can also affect its energy efficiency. For example, overloading the crusher can cause it to consume more energy than necessary. Operators should ensure that the crusher is fed with the appropriate amount of material and that the material is of the correct size and hardness. Additionally, regular maintenance and lubrication of the crusher can help keep it running smoothly and reduce energy consumption.
